Brick walls are exposed to the elements all of the time, which makes brick patch services a requirement at some point along the way. Brick patch is done when there are missing or damaged bricks in a wall, which can occur for a number of reasons.

When You Might Need Brick Patch Work

The most common call that masonry professionals receive for brick patch work is when a hole has been drilled into brick. This may happen if you ever need to move wires in the walls of your home and drilling was required to access them. When left uncovered, these holes allow all manner of dirt, water and debris to infiltrate the wall. This can potentially lead to structural problems within the brick and even the wall itself.

That is why brick patch is so important when you have a hole in your brick wall. Additionally, visible holes will affect the overall appearance of the structure. Who wants to deal with that?

There are two approaches to brick patch work: repairing the brick with mortar and repairing it with a silicone caulk.

Repairing Brick with Mortar

Brick patching can be done with mortar. This is done by professional masons in a relatively simple and straightforward step-by-step fashion:

  1. The brick is cleaned to ensure a suitable surface. This helps to make sure that there is no dirt, debris or other grime that will impact the mortar as it’s applied.
  2. Using either brick dust or a concrete pigment, the mortar is mixed until it matches the pigment of the brick that’s being repaired.
  3. The hole is then filled with the pigmented mortar. Usually the hole will be filled just a little more than the hole is deep.
  4. A matching brick is pressed to the mortar that stands out from inside of the hole. This guarantees the newly patched brick will match its surroundings by imprinting the texture onto the remaining mortar mixture.

Repairing Brick with Caulk

A silicone caulk can be used in alternative to mortar. The process is very similar to the brick patching done using mortar.

  1. The brick is cleaned. First, it will be brushed with wire to ensure that nothing resides in the grooves and valleys of the brick’s texture.
  2. Compressed air is then blown into the hole to make double-sure that there is no remaining debris that will affect the caulk.
  3. The mason will use a silicone caulk that closely resembles the color of the existing brick. This caulk will fill the hole in the brick. Just like with mortar, the caulk will be filled just slightly above the surface of the brick.
  4. Brick dust is applied to a trowel and then pressed against the brick. This ensures the same color and texture of the existing brick so that it doesn’t stand out among the others in the wall.

Brick patch is an important step to take when you notice a hole or a chip in an exterior brick wall. Fortunately, brick patch is an easy task for an experienced mason.
